Self-leveling resin techniques
Self-leveling resin techniques are used to create uniform and smooth surfaces on indoor and outdoor floors. This type of resin, composed of epoxy or polyurethane polymers, self-levels during application, eliminating irregularities and imperfections. Typical phases of the process include preparing the support, mixing the resin with the catalyst, applying it on the surface, and leveling it with a spatula or roller. Self-leveling resin is appreciated for its resistance to wear, chemicals, and extreme temperatures, making it ideal for industrial, commercial, and residential flooring.
Tutorial for spreading self-leveling resin
To spread self-leveling resin, carefully follow these steps: 1. Prepare the surface: make sure it is clean, dry, and free of dust and dirt. 2. Mix the resin: following the manufacturer's instructions, thoroughly mix the resin and hardener. 3. Pour the resin: pour it on the surface evenly. 4. Spread the resin: use a specific roller for self-leveling resins to distribute it evenly. 5. Level the resin: use a spatula to remove any air bubbles and achieve a smooth surface. 6. Allow it to dry: follow the drying times indicated by the manufacturer. 7. Apply a second coat if necessary to achieve the desired thickness.
Tips for applying self-leveling resin
Applying self-leveling resin requires precision and attention to achieve optimal results. Here are some useful tips: - Prepare the surface carefully: make sure it is clean, dry, and free of dust and grease. - Mix the resin following the manufacturer's instructions carefully to ensure a homogeneous mixture. - Pour the resin on the area to be covered and distribute it evenly with a roller to avoid air bubbles. - Use a spike roller to remove any bubbles in the resin. - Follow the drying and curing times indicated to obtain a smooth and uniform surface.
